NMM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2014 in Review
85 of the 3,751 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Navios Maritime Partners (NMM) for Q4 2014, worth a combined $244M — down 44% from $438M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 20 funds opened new NMM positions and 17 closed out — a net gain of 3 holders — while 29 added to existing stakes and 23 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Invesco, adding an estimated $24.8M. The largest seller was Goldman Sachs, exiting entirely with an estimated $59.7M sold.
